Output 6520e82a3e1be29369c79b04f74e14655d02c0574595283f89debb0f3b800bab:0

value
11492744
script pubkey
OP_0 OP_PUSHBYTES_20 8ab3bf11bd3d7c447a8c7abff15c4e12c9ea1390
address
bc1q32em7yda847yg75v02llzhzwzty75yusqnmw9c
transaction
6520e82a3e1be29369c79b04f74e14655d02c0574595283f89debb0f3b800bab
spent
true